Cheesy Ham and Hash Brown Casserole

This Cheesy Ham and Hash Brown Casserole is a creamy, hearty dish perfect for feeding a crowd at brunches, potlucks, or holidays, featuring tender potatoes, savory ham, and a golden cheesy topping.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 1 hour
Total Time 1 hour 25 minutes
Course Brunch, Main Course
Cuisine American
Servings 12 servings
Calories 286 kcal

Ingredients
  

Main Ingredients

  • 1 32-oz. package frozen diced hash browns or 1 (30-oz.) package frozen shredded hash browns
  • 2 10.5-oz. cans condensed cream of potato soup
  • 1 16-oz. container sour cream
  • 2 cups shredded sharp cheddar cheese (about 8 oz.)
  • 8 oz. cooked diced ham (about 1 1/2 cups)
  • 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ese (about 2 oz.)
  • Snipped fresh chives (for topping)

Optional Ingredients

  • 1/2 cup diced onion (adds sweetness and extra savory depth)
  • 1/2 cup diced bell pepper (great for color and crunch)
  • 1-2 tsp garlic powder (boosts flavor fast)
  • 1/2 tsp smoked paprika (adds a subtle smoky note)
  • 1-2 Tbsp hot sauce (if you like a gentle kick)
  • 1 cup crushed cornflakes or buttery crackers + 2 Tbsp melted butter (optional topping)

Instructions
 

Preparation

  • Preheat your oven to 350°F.
  • Lightly grease a 9x13-inch baking dish (butter or nonstick spray both work).
  • If your hash browns look heavily frosted, let them sit at room temperature for 10 minutes while you measure ingredients.

Mixing / Assembling

  • In a large bowl, stir together the hash browns, cream of potato soup, sour cream, cheddar cheese, and diced ham until everything is evenly coated.
  • Spread the mixture into the prepared baking dish and smooth the top.
  • Sprinkle Parmesan over the surface for a salty, golden finish.

Cooking / Baking

  • Bake uncovered for about 60 minutes, or until the casserole is hot, bubbly, and the top looks melted and lightly golden.
  • If the top starts browning faster than you like, loosely tent with foil for the final 10–15 minutes.

Resting / Finishing

  • Let the casserole stand for 10 minutes before serving.
  • Sprinkle with fresh chives right before serving.

Notes

Tips: Use different varieties of cheese or add-ins to customize. Letting the casserole rest prevents it from losing shape when cut. Freeze leftovers for future meals.
